§657-36 Same. If, when the right of action first accrues, the person entitled thereto is under any of the disabilities mentioned in section 657-34, and dies without having recovered the premises, no further time for making the entry or bringing the action, beyond what is prescribed in section 657-35, shall be allowed by reason of the disability of any other person. [L 1870, c 22, §6; RL 1925, §2662; RL 1935, §3933; RL 1945, §10444; RL 1955, §241-35; HRS §657-36]
